The PR potential of ‘micro scandals’

Gawker Media was taken to the woodshed over a blog site it launched dedicated to the HBO series True Blood . The blog, BloodCopy , is a sponsored site—an ad—for the show. Media outlets have reported on this development, and many bloggers and commentators cried foul. The result: even more coverage for the site and HBO. Did Gawker engineer the scandal? Probably not.
